One more satisfying weekend with an extremely close race for #1, good holds and two ok openers. Kung Fu Panda 4 dropped only 13% (but family releases were very strong anyway, as witnessed by the increases for Le Dernier Jaguar and Migration) and Dune 2 has crossed 2mil total with another sub-30% drop. The 5th Ghostbusters movie opened better than #4 and above my expectations, and french comedy Cocorico was off to an ok start but might catch on. The Zone of Interest had its first drop but is still on the level of its OW - super.
In Austria, KFP4 was #1 again, dropping the same 13% as in Germany but from a higher level, it's already >100k admissions after WE2. Dune 2 and Ghostbusters 5 were about on the same level as Germany (Dune now >250k after the weekend) but Cocorico opened a lot better, already near 15k after ist first WE. On #5 and #6 we had Andrea lässt sich scheiden (has now crossed 150k total) and Anyone But You (has crossed 250k but with no chance for the Golden Ticket). Migration however has finally broken this 300k treshold - congratulations!
Next weekend: A domestic #1 should be safe with Chantal im Märchenland, a tie-in to the extremely successful "Fack Ju Göhte"-comedies. While the last of those came out in 2017, they're still popular and something like a 5-600k OW wouldn't surprise me. Also opening: Wicked Little Letters, Club Zero and One Life. My guess is that Ghostbusters will get hit harder than Dune, but overall, business should see a fine uptick!

On 3/11/2024 at 9:50 AM, Elessar said:
If he knows all the possible futures then wouldn't he also know how to prevent it? How to prevent millions from dying? Why can't he escape from destiny? Terminator taught me "There's no fate but what we make for ourselves".
It's not as if he isn't trying. And he succeeds (kind of), at least in the books, in that he removes himself from the picture as far as possible. But like when a dam bursts, there's only very little one can do to influence the disasterous course of the flood. And Paul, while removing himself, just manages to put the weight in someone elses hands (his children's). In fact, most of the later Dune books (starting with God Emperor) are about how Leto tries to escape from the forces of history.

A good weekend - and a lot stronger than the corresponding one last year, finally!
Dune 2 had an excellent hold, it's still 75% ahead of the first on and having better holds, so I think 3,5mil total are the goal atm. Kung Fu Panda 4 was also improving a lot from ist predecessors; 1,5mil total should be easily doable and depending on WOM it can of course get to 2mil. Imaginary opened higher than Miller's Girl but both had a so-so PTA. And The Zone of Interest is a phenomenon; seems to have crazy good WOM so I can see it getting to 1mil total, a big success for such an arthousey release! Farther down the chart, some old releases got re-expansions and managed to add to their totals (Poor Things has now crossed 500k)
In Austria, #1 and 2 were reversed as KFP4 opened to #1; it's already over 60k total so stronger than in Germany. Dune 2 dropped steeper than in Germany (-32%) but it was already at 208k total after Sunday, so basically head-to-head. On #3 we had domestic dramedy Andrea lässt sich scheiden which was at 142k total after Sunday but was down to 10,8k admissons in its 4th weekend so 200k are probably out of reach - still, a surprising success! On #4 longrunning Anyone But You (by now at 247k total, much stronger than Germany); on #5 and 6 Imaginary and Miller's Girl which opened about head-to-head as in Germany. The Zone of Interest was only #7, total is now a bit over 20k - that's one of the rare releases where Germany is pulling ahead!

Nice weekend (even if we're still down compared to last year). Dune 2 with a fine hold - Dune 1 was at 792k after the 2nd WE, so it's ahead by >70% - I can see it getting near 3,5mil total. And The Zone of Interest even had an increase, astonishing - let's see how far it can get! Also an excellent opening for documentation Wunderland, and Kung Fu Panda 4 hat nearly 90k previews on Sunday! Biopic La Nouvelle Femme was also pretty strong (more screens than I had guessed).
In Austria, the weekend was even stronger - Dune 2 fell only 15% and was at nearly 156k after Sunday; Andrea lässt sich scheiden continues its strong run and was at 122k and Anyone But You was #3 and hit 238k total, much stronger than in Germany! Migration should hit 300k total on Thursday, also way ahead of Germany.
Next weekend: Despite having burnt some demand with those Sunday previews, Kung Fu Panda 4 should have a fine OW - it may become a close race for #1 with Dune 2. Also opening, on a smaller scale: Miller's Girl (very low presales).

A strong opening by Dune 2 - that's about 75% increase from the first one! Of course it's too early to be sure but 3mil total look very likely and with the good reception it's getting, I'm hoping for a bit more. And an even stronger opening (going by expectations) for The Zone of Interest; that's a badass PTA for such a release - I have no idea how that happened, maybe a lot of school shows? Good for the market though; despite the fine openers the overall market is down once more compared to last year (which was already dreadful).
In Austria, once more, a much stronger weekend. While The Zone of Interest opened only half as strong as in Germany (meaning: in line with expectations), most other releases were doing better - Dune 2 was at 76,5k on Sunday, Anyone But You and Le Dernier Jaguar were still in the 5-digit range, Wonka has now crossed 350k total - but the most impressive release atm is domestic Andrea lässt sich scheiden which had nearly 32k again (3day), a drop of only 14% from an already astonishing OW on a weekend with a massive opener! It was already at 89k total on Sunday which means it's even getting about 5k admissions each weekday!
Next weekend: Thriller comedy Drive-Away Dolls might get a few admissions, as might biopic La Nouvelle femme about Maria Montessori (persumably with school shows), but this week's Top3 should stay on top. The big question, of course, is, how well Dune 2 can hold in its 2nd weekend - a 35% drop would put it around 400k which would still top the first one's OW - let's keep those fingers crossed!
